admin 管理员组文章数量: 1184232
2024年3月21日发(作者:switch和ns图怎么画)
Excel高级函数利用INDEX和MATCH进行
复杂数据查找和提取
Excel是一种非常强大的电子表格软件,广泛应用于数据分析、数
据处理和信息管理等领域。在Excel中,高级函数INDEX和MATCH
的结合可以帮助用户实现复杂数据的查找和提取,为数据分析和决策
提供强有力的支持。
一、INDEX函数的基本用法
INDEX函数是Excel中常用的一个查找函数,它可以根据给定的行
号和列号,在一个给定的区域中返回指定位置的值。
INDEX函数的基本语法如下:
INDEX(区域, 行数, 列数)
区域:表示要查找的数据区域;
行数:表示要返回的值所在的行号;
列数:表示要返回的值所在的列号。
例如,如果我们有一个表格的数据区域是A1:C5,现在想要获取第
3行第2列的数值,可以使用INDEX函数的如下方式:
INDEX(A1:C5, 3, 2)
二、MATCH函数的基本用法
MATCH函数是Excel中另一个常用的查找函数,它可以在一个给
定的区域中查找特定的值,并返回该值在区域中的位置。
MATCH函数的基本语法如下:
MATCH(查找值, 区域, 匹配类型)
查找值:表示要查找的值;
区域:表示要进行查找的数据区域;
匹配类型:表示匹配的方式,可以是0、1或-1。0表示精确匹配,
1表示查找比查找值大的最小值,-1表示查找比查找值小的最大值。
例如,如果我们有一个表格的数据区域是A1:A5,现在想要查找数
值为10的单元格的位置,可以使用MATCH函数的如下方式:
MATCH(10, A1:A5, 0)
三、利用INDEX和MATCH进行复杂数据查找和提取
利用INDEX和MATCH的结合,我们可以实现更加灵活和复杂的
数据查找和提取。
首先,我们需要确定要查找的数据区域,例如一个包含了销售数据
的表格区域A1:D10。接下来,我们可以根据具体的需求和条件,利用
MATCH函数查找符合条件的行或列的位置。例如,我们想要找到产品
名称为"苹果"的销售数据,可以使用MATCH函数找到产品名称所在
的列号。假设产品名称在表格中的位置是A1:D1,我们可以使用如下
公式:
MATCH("苹果", A1:D1, 0)
得到产品名称所在的列号后,我们可以利用INDEX函数根据该列
号和特定的行号,获取对应的销售数据。例如,我们想要获取产品名
称为"苹果"的第5行销售数据,可以使用如下公式:
INDEX(A1:D10, 5, MATCH("苹果", A1:D1, 0))
通过以上的操作,我们可以实现简单的数据查找和提取。根据具体
的需求,我们还可以结合其他条件和函数,进一步筛选和处理数据。
四、注意事项和扩展用法
在使用INDEX和MATCH函数时,需要注意以下几点:
1. 区域的选择:区域应该正确选择,确保包含了要查找和提取的数
据。
2. 数值匹配:MATCH函数在匹配数值时,可能会受到数值精度和
格式的影响,需要确保匹配的数值类型一致。
3. 错误处理:当数据不存在或条件不满足时,函数可能返回错误值,
需要进行错误处理和异常情况的判断。
除了基本的用法外,INDEX和MATCH函数还可以结合其他函数
进行更加复杂和灵活的数据处理操作,例如结合IF函数、SUM函数等,
实现更多的数据分析和统计功能。
总结:
Excel的INDEX和MATCH函数是非常实用的高级函数,通过它们
的结合可以实现复杂数据的查找和提取。它们可以广泛应用于数据分
析、数据处理和信息管理等各种场景,为用户提供了强有力的数据处
理和分析能力。在使用时需要注意函数的语法和参数设置,并结合具
体的需求进行灵活的应用。通过掌握和熟练运用INDEX和MATCH函
数,可以提高工作效率,提取有价值的信息,实现科学决策和数据驱
动的管理。
版权声明:本文标题:Excel高级函数利用INDEX和MATCH进行复杂数据查找和提取 内容由网友自发贡献,该文观点仅代表作者本人, 转载请联系作者并注明出处:http://www.roclinux.cn/p/1711016164a584177.html, 本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,一经查实,本站将立刻删除。
发表评论